A bucket of water has a leak on its lower side. As the water goes down, what happens to the speed of the water coming out of the hole?

It increases

It stays the same

It decreases

It reverses

Impossible to tell

A cylindrical metal tank filled with air is submerged underwater. As the air escapes, the tank gradually moves deeper underwater. Which statement provides the best reason for this motion?

The bubbles provide a downward thrust on the tank

The metal increases in density so it gets heavier

The bubbles lower the density of the water which lowers its buoyancy

Water replaces the air in the tank which makes it heavier

Impossible to tell

It is a cold winter and a well-insulated house has its heater turned on. The front door is opened and cold air rushes in. If the wind speed outside is very low, how would the cold air enter the house?

Scenario A, the cold air will flow towards the floor

Scenario B, the cold air will flow towards the ceiling

A combination of A and B

The cold air will not enter the house

Impossible to tell

Bolt croppers have long handles with grips that are located as far away as possible from the neck. Which statement provides the best reason for this design?

Long handles make the cutting edges move faster

It provides mechanical advantage which allows cutting through thick bolts

The appearance of the tool is significantly more aesthetic with longer hadles

It makes the bolt croppers more durable if dropped accidently

Longer handles are more ergonomic and allows easier storage

Convex mirrors are used for rear-view mirrors of vehicles. What is the advantage of using a convex mirror instead of a flat mirror?

It provides a clearer reflection

It has a more accurate reflection

The wider angle of view reduces blind spots

It is easier to clean a convex mirror

A convex mirror provides no advantage

A car is behind a fire appliance on a motorway. The appliance is travelling at a speed of 60 mph. If the distance between the two moving vehicles is not changing, what is the cars speed?

80 mph

65 mph

60 mph

50 mph

55 mph
